Rate of clearance of virulent Treponema pallidum (Nichols) from the blood stream of normal, Mycobacterium bovis BCG-treated, and immune syphilitic rabbits.

S Graves

ABSTRACT

The rate of clearance of virulent Treponema pallidum (Nichols) from the blood stream of normal rabbits and rabbits previously treated with Mycobacterium bovis BCG was similar, there being treponemes still circulating 8 h after intravenous inoculation. In contrast, immune syphilitic rabbits cleared the virulent treponemes within 1 to 2 hours. Rabbits with passive humoral immunity to T. pallidum (after the transfer of 70 ml of immune serum) showed a similar clearance rate to that of the immune rabbits. Rabbits previously treated with BCG and with passive humoral immunity did not show a synergistic enhanced clearance rate, it being similar to that of immune rabbits.
